How To Store Leftover Chicken

Let the grilled chicken sit a room temperature about 10 minutes to cool off, then refrigerate or freeze based on the times below.

  • Refrigerate in a sealed container up to 34 days.
  • Freeze whole, shredded, or chopped pieces tightly sealed up to 34 months. I like to freeze in separate smaller bags for easy leftover portions.

Grilling Times At A Glance

Grilled Chicken Breast

These grilling times are based on a minimal internal temperature of 165 degrees F, as recommended by the USDA.

  • Boneless chicken breasts: 7 to 8 minutes per side
  • Bone-in chicken breasts: 15 minutes per side
  • Boneless, skinless chicken thighs: 5 to 6 minutes per side;
  • Bone-in chicken thighs: 8 to 10 minutes per side;
  • Chicken wings: 25 minutes total, flipping occasionally;

How Long Does It Take To Grill Bone

It takes approximately 45 minutes to grill bone-in chicken breast. A lot of this will depend on how hot you are running grill and if you are finishing the cooking on in-direct heating. You want to check the meat and get a reading of 165°F with an instant-read thermometer.

How To Make A Marinade For Grilled Chicken Breasts

A marinade is the perfect way to add flavor to grilled chicken . I try to allow for 30 minutes or more if possible! There are a few essential ingredients in a marinade.

  • Oil:; Most often the base of marinades.
  • Acid: This helps tenderize the meat by breaking down tougher proteins
  • Sugar: Helps with flavor and the caramelization process. .
  • Seasonings: This is the flavor profile, you can use anything from Italian seasoning to curry powder to season your marinade.; This may or may not include salt.
  • Time: Give yourself time to allow your meat to marinade.; The purpose of the marinade is not only to add flavor but to help tenderize your meat.

How Long to Marinate Chicken

Allow chicken to marinate 30 min to 4hrs. This allows enough time for the marinade to work its magic and add flavor while tenderizing the meat.

Longer than 4 hours can change the texture of the chicken making it mushy.

Mix Up A Marinade Dry Rub Or Brine

Unless glazing with a barbecue sauce, always season your chicken, whether it’s boneless breasts or the whole bird. Wet marinades, dry rubs and brines all add flavor and moisture to chicken breasts and can also act as a tenderizer. Here’s what to know about each type:

A wet marinade is any type of highly seasoned liquid, such as herb or spice pastes, wines, spiced oils, vinaigrettes, yogurt/buttermilk, Cuban mojo, etc. If a marinade includes something very acidic, like vinegar, wine or citrus, keep the marinating time relatively quick 30 minutes to three hours, depending upon the thickness of the chicken breast and cut it with a little olive oil. Yogurt and buttermilk, which are both rich in lactic acid, are much less acidic and can stand a longer marinating time two to six hours, depending upon the chicken’s thickness. Non-acidic marinades, like herbs and spices mixed with oils, can sit for two to 10 hours.

Can I Substitute Table Salt In The Brine

We don’t recommend using table salt in this brine. There’s a big difference between the size of kosher salt flakes and table salt grains. Using table salt will add much more salt to this brine recipe, and the chicken will come out too salty.

If table salt is all you have, use 1 1/2 tablespoons of table salt in this recipe. You can also use 1 1/2 tablespoons of fine sea salt.

Dont Overcook This Is Super Important

Chicken doesnt take long to cook. If you over cook it, the chicken will be come dry and wont taste great.

If you pull it off right as the chicken is done, you will have moist and delicious chicken. On average chicken should take about 15 minutes to cook on a gas grill.

12 minutes if you chicken is thin and 20 minutes if you chicken is thicker.

You can also use a meat thermometer to check the internal temperature. The chicken needs to have an internal temperature of 165 degrees F.

The Best Chicken For Grilling

For the juiciest, most flavorful grilled chicken, use bone-in, skin-on pieces. Place the chicken on a paper towel-lined tray and pat it dry. This removes excess moisture, which prevents the skin from getting crispy. Remember to wash your hands and all equipment after handling raw chicken.

Next, season both sides generously with kosher salt and freshly ground pepper and allow the chicken to come to room temperature for 15 minutes. This helps it cook evenly and gives the salt and pepper a chance to work their magic. Keep in mind that sweet sauces like glazes and barbecue sauce shouldn’t be applied until the chicken is finished cooking. They will burn before the chicken is fully cooked.

Make Sure The Chicken Is Not Too Thick And All The Pieces Are Even

I like to make sure each piece of chicken is about the same thickness so everything cooks evenly. You can use a meat tenderizer to pound the chicken and even it out if needed.

If one piece of chicken is thick on one end and thin on the other, it can make cooking difficult. I find it is an easy fix by simply pounding it all to even the chicken out.

The Recipe: How To Grill Perfectly Tender Chicken Breasts Every Time

What you need:;I use pink;Himalayan Salt;for brining but you can also use kosher salt.

  • Place water and salt in a large bowl and stir.
  • Place chicken breast between folded parchment paper and pound with a rolling pin until uniformly thick.
  • Place breasts in salt water for 30 minutes.
  • Remove breasts, pat dry with paper towels.
  • Brush with olive oil and season with salt and pepper.
  • Heat grill on high
  • Place breasts on grill, close lid and cook till nice golden grill marks are established
  • Turn over and grill till golden on the second side
  • Turn heat to med/low close lid and cook for five more minutes until just cooked through. Don’t over cook!
  • Remove from grill, cut on the diagonal and serve.

    How Long To Grill Chicken Breast

    This answer can fluctuate depending on how hot your grill gets and the thickness of your chicken breasts.

    In this grilled chicken breast recipe, I dont pound my chicken out unless it is extremely thick in some parts and thin in other parts. Once your chicken breasts are marinated, place them on the grill. Cook them for 7-8 minutes on each side, not lifting during the cooking process

    Flip your chicken and cook for an additional 7-8 minutes, or until a meat thermometer inserted into the largest part of the chicken breast reads 165°F.

    It is important to allow your chicken to rest about 3-5 minutes before cutting to keep it juicy .;Serve with your favorite sides, and preferably on a patio with a big pitcher of Easy White Sangria!
